Eliminate conf_lock and instead rely on the NSS write lock to protect

NSS configuration state.

As a side effect, this fixes a race condition which can occur if multiple
threads call nsdispatch(3) concurrently before nsswitch.conf has been
parsed. Previously, the thread holding conf_lock could cause other threads
to return from nss_configure() before nsswitch.conf had been parsed, forcing
them to fall back to the default sources for their NSS methods.
